Find out if you have corporate clutter....


See how do you score on the following scenarios
 

1.  You’ve got your work appraisal coming up. As you review your objectives from last year (no one actually reads them in-between, do they?!), you realise that one of your objectives was to ‘be tidier and more organised.’ You look at your desk and;


a) try to think of an excuse as to why you haven’t improved - a big project you’ve been involved in, a big change in the office, or blame someone else who’s been using your desk.

b) realise that although your desk is tidier, you're no more organised because it's all hidden in your drawers, out of sight, and in truth you still can't find anything.

c) think ‘that’s one objective I can tick off the list to do’.

 

2.  You’re in an interview for a job which would involve setting up an office at home. You are asked how you would manage the demands of running all the administration yourself without office support, and what steps you would take to ensure your procedures linked in with the head office. Do you:


a) Pretend you’re the most organised person that they could ever meet – it’s not like they’re ever going to see that you can’t even get in your spare room which you loosely call the ‘office’. You’ll just clear a space on the dining room table instead and work from there.

b) You know which room you’ll have as your ‘office’, but you’ll just concentrate on the important thing of doing the job and then deal with any administration issues as and when the ‘moaning e-mail’ comes round.

c) You’re so confident of getting the job you’ve already put up shelves, ordered the desk and chair, and thought about how you’ll make time to do a little bit of admin each week to keep on top of it.

 

3.  At Christmas your office is open between Christmas and New Year, and you are one of very few people who choose to go into the office and work. Is this because:


a) It’s so quiet you can get loads of work done unlike the rest of the year.

b) In theory so you can have a sort out, but as you begin to sort through your ‘in tray’ you find things that need dealing with so end up doing work instead of sorting things.

c) It’s a great time to have a clear out of your desk and files because the phone’s aren’t ringing, there are no meetings, and you can use other people’s desks to have a good sort out of paperwork.

 

SCORE:


Mainly A’s

You’ve got clutter – and it’s taking over your life because you don’t want anyone to see it. You definitely need to sort out the clutter!  

Mainly B’s

You’re good at hiding the clutter from people, but confining it to one room or area isn’t going to help sort it out – clutter clearing might just help.

Mainly C’s

Sounds like you already know how to clear your clutter and keep it under control – congratulations! Maybe you know, or live with some ‘mainly A’s and mainly B’s’ who could do with some help!
